PT100 temperature sensor - Universal probe for measuring high temperature
Platinum temperature meters are extremely versatile transmitters of this physical size. The probes use platinum thermoresistors as a temperature sensor, so they can operate in a very wide temperature range. Basically, the thermoresistor itself is designed to operate in the range from -200°C to 800°C , however, the resulting operating temperature range of such a probe is also influenced by the housing, cables and other elements used. Select models may offer a lower maximum operating temperature.
Since the change in resistance through a platinum sensor is a well-characterized physical process, these types of meters are highly precise. Platinum resistance thermometers
PT sensors are a series of platinum temperature meters that use platinum thermoresistors as transducers of temperature into an electrical value, in this case resistance. For most metals, the change in resistance as a function of temperature is linear, making them excellent sensors for measuring this physical quantity. The PT series consists of PT100, PT500 and PT1000 probes. The number in the name indicates the resistance of the sensor at 0°C. Despite the use of an expensive metal - platinum - these probes have a low price because they contain small amounts of this metal.

Linear characteristic for easy measurement
Since the change in resistance as a function of temperature is linear for metals, PT100 transmitters also have linear characteristics . This is extremely important when implementing this type of sensors, because it eliminates the need for complex conversion of electrical value into temperature.
